What dessert is traditionally served at Wimbledon?

Strawberries and cream is the Wimbledon Signature Food. You'll find deliciously fresh English Strawberries are commonly served to spectators. These tend to be bright red and amazingly juicy, with a slight tart taste to them.

What is the history of Strawberries and Cream

What is the significance of strawberries and cream at Wimbledon, and how did it become a tradition? Wimbledon is usually held in late June/Early July, which is when English Strawberries originally come into season. In fact, in the first Wimbeldon, spectators were served with Strawberries and Cream!

Interestingly, the tradition of strawberries and cream goes more than just the season it's ripe from. During the 1500’s, England was under the rule of Henry VIII, who lived in Hampton Court Palace for some time. The kitchens here would serve several hundreds of people daily, and so the pressure was on for quick desserts. Cardinal Thomas Wolsey was King Henry VIII’s right hand man, and one day his kitchen served the desert of Strawberries and Cream to the King, who was blown away. Now this doesn’t seem like that big of a deal for why are strawberries eaten with cream, but back in this age – The King eating this dish was significant. Dairy produce was seen as peasant food, and was not often consumed by royalty. Hearing the King himself was eating cream meant that the common peasants of the Kingdom could almost get a feel for royalty, by chowing down on the very same dish.

How much strawberries and cream are consumed at Wimbledon?

Every year, over 38.4 tonnes of strawberries and over 7,000 litres of cream are consumed at the tournament. This equates to about 1.92 million strawberries. This doesn't even include those who are eating the homemade dish from behind their television screens!

How much are strawberries and cream at Wimbledon 2025?

Wimbledon charges £2.50 per portion of Strawberries and Cream. This price hasn't changed since 2010, and you'll get 10 strawberries with cream in your serving.

Strawberries and Cream Calories

A typical serving of Strawberries and Cream will be between 240 and 340 calories. The calories are dependent on how much of each you're getting, and can naturally go outside of this range.

Easy Strawberries and Cream Recipe

Thankfully, there’s not many steps in how to make strawberries and cream, and it’s pretty straight forward.

To make your own Strawberries and Cream dessert you’ll need:

  • Strawberries (we recommend English Strawberries)
  • Cream (double cream works best) - (250ml)
  • Granulated Sugar - (80g Sugar)
  • Vanila Extract - (½ teaspoon)

English Strawberries and cream recipe:

  1. Remove the stems out of the strawberries, and cut them into equal sizes.
  2. Add the strawberries and some sugar (about a tablespoon) into a bowl and mix gently. Set aside in fridge until needed. You can add more or less sugar depending on how sweet your want your strawberries to be.
  3. Gently stir the vanilla extract into a bowl with the cream, along with about 60g of sugar. Again, you can add more or less sugar depending on how sweet you want the cream.
  4. Whip the cream until it forms soft peaks.
  5. This part is largely up to you on how you want to present your Wimbledon inspired dessert. We recommend pouring some of the strawberries into the bottom of a bowl, then layer with some cream. Create another layer of strawberries, then pour more cream on top. You can add a couple strawberries to garnish.
